Analog to digital converter (ADC) is used to convert an analog signal into a digital signal.
Resolution of ADC means in how many parts the signal of interest can be divided.
The resolution can be found using
Q = Full scale Voltage range/2^M
Where the full scale voltage range is 10 V and M is the number of bits of the ADC.
Q = 10/2^6
Q = 10/64
Q = 0.156 V
Therefore, the smallest voltage difference that can be detectable by this ADC is 0.156 V
